Eid-Ul Adha 2025 Date in India: The festival of Eid-ul-Azha is celebrated on the 10th of Zul Hijja. The moon has been sighted in Saudi Arabia on the evening of Tuesday, May 27, 2025 and Bakrid will be celebrated there on June 6.
Like Eid in Islam, the festival of Eid ul-Azha is also considered very sacred. It is also known by names like Eid-ul-Zuha, Bakrid or Qurbani. Bakrid is an important festival celebrated by the people of the Muslim community around the world, which is celebrated on the 10th of Zul-Hijja or Dhul-Hijja according to the Islamic calendar.
Zul-Hijja moon seen in Saudi
Almost all the festivals of Islam are based on the moon and the date is confirmed only after the moon is seen. Similarly, there was confusion about the date of Bakrid. But on Tuesday, 27 May 2025, the moon was seen in Saudi Arabia after Mahrib.
With this, Zul-Hijja (12th month of Islamic calendar) also started. Let us tell you that in Islam, Zul-Hijja is considered the second special and holy month after Ramadan.
Because many Islamic and religious activities take place in this month, such as the beginning of Haj in Mecca, the day of Afra and the festival of Eid ul-Azha.
After the sighting of the moon of Zul-Hijja in Saudi Arabia, the date of Eid ul-Azha has also been announced. This festival will be celebrated there on 6 June. Its official information has been given by the Supreme Court of Saudi on 'X'. Let us know when Eid-ul-Azha will be celebrated in India.
Bakrid on 7 June in India
The date of Bakrid has been fixed in Saudi Arabia and it has also been officially announced. But when will Bakrid be in India, let us know. Actually, the moon will be seen on 28 May in India, Pakistan, Bangladesh and other South Asian countries.
If the moon is seen today, then Dhul-Hijja will start from 29 May and the festival of Eid-ul-Azha will be celebrated on its 10th day. In such a situation, Bakrid will be celebrated in India on Saturday 7 June 2025.
